Stock Market Today, Sept. 17: CoreWeave Falls on Convertible Debt and Share Sale Announcement

Source Motley_fool

CoreWeave (NASDAQ:CRWV), a GPU-accelerated cloud infrastructure provider, closed at $79.88, down 4.16%. The stock fell after CoreWeave announced convertible debt and a share sale, and investors are watching financing costs and infrastructure expansion.
Trading volume reached 78.3 million shares, coming in about 176% above its three-month average of 28.4 million shares. CoreWeave IPO'd in 2025 and has doubled since going public.

How the markets moved today

The S&P 500 (SNPINDEX:^GSPC) closed at 7,637, up 1.13%, while the Nasdaq Composite (NASDAQINDEX:^IXIC) closed at 26,418, up 1.69%. Among specialized cloud computing and AI infrastructure services peers, Nebius Group (NASDAQ:NBIS) closed at $217.99, up 4.12%, and Iren (NASDAQ:IREN) closed at $43.48, up 2.02%, as investors kept weighing AI buildout demand against funding needs.

What this means for investors

It's important to note why CoreWeave stock dropped while shares of its closest peers rose sharply today. The companies are in a capital-intensive spending growth stretch. Demand for high-powered compute cloud space for AI is huge, and CoreWeave announced today that it would raise money to meet that demand in two ways.

Its share offering and convertible bond offering are both likely to be dilutive to shareholders. But it takes money to make money, and CoreWeave also reinforced today that it is raising prices for its compute cloud contracts.

But the debt and share issuance contrasts with the solid cash position of peer Iren, for example. Iren has built up cash from its existing crypto mining operations.

I believe both are in a sweet spot for AI compute demand, but Iren has the better balance sheet, and that may be why investors bid its stock price higher today, while CoreWeave dropped.
